u having problems with morel with just the warhawk block or just in general?
It looks like with just the warhawk. It has to do with the edge orfice that sends oil up the pushrod. It is croos drilled and "falls'' into the oil galley allowing all the oil to flow up the pushrod. We sent them back to morel to have one side plugged.
When they get back I will make a post about it with pics.
FWIW the jesel is already plugged.

Too much to get into for an internet thread basically. There's a lot to go wrong and you just have to know how it all works. I have had to return most "LS1" solid roller lifters that people have supplied me with and use what I know works with that lobe lift and design etc. Several of the solid rollers will lose nearly all your oil pressure and some cannot mechanically accomodate that much lift and some require extensive block modifications to not bind up. When you get into the really bigger lobe lift stuff it just gets even worse.
